Comparison
Garden City vs Topeka
Garden City has the lower salary-needed estimate, while Garden City has the lower starter rent. Differences are shown as Topeka minus Garden City.
| Metric | Garden City | Topeka | Difference | Advantage | Why |
|---|
| Median rent | $824 | $946 | +$122 | Garden City | Garden City has the lower median rent. |
| Home price | $235,086 | $206,400 | -$28,686 | Topeka | Topeka has the lower home price. |
| Utilities | $197/mo | $180/mo | -$17/mo | Topeka | Topeka has the lower utilities. |
| Groceries index | 101 | 97 | -4 | Topeka | Topeka has the lower groceries index. |
| Salary needed | $42,917 | $47,700 | +$4,783 | Garden City | Garden City has the lower salary needed. |
| Move score | 83/100 | 84/100 | +1 | Topeka | Topeka has the higher move score. |
